English
Noun
DH (plural DHs)
- (baseball) Initialism of designated hitter.
- (aviation) Initialism of decision height.
- (military, nautical) Initialism of heavy destroyer, a variant of the destroyer type of warship.
- Initialism of deputy head.
- Initialism of dear/darling husband.

Somali
Pronunciation
- (phoneme): IPA(key): /ɖ/
- (letter name): IPA(key): /ɖɑ/
Letter
DH upper case (lower case dh)
- The eleventh letter of the Somali alphabet, called dha and written in the Latin script.
Usage notes
- The eleventh letter of the Somali alphabet, which follows Arabic abjad order. It is preceded by SH and followed by C.
